About this route:
A direct, nonstop flight between Yalinga Airport (AIG), Yalinga, Central African Republic and Minsk National Airport (MSQ), Minsk, Belarus would travel a Great Circle distance of 3,283 miles (or 5,284 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the large distance between Yalinga Airport and Minsk National Airport, the route shown on this map most likely appears curved because of this reason.

Facts about Minsk National Airport (MSQ):
- The airport serves as hub of the national Belarussian airline Belavia and the cargo carriers TransAVIAexport Airlines and Genex.
- Car rental services are provided by Europcar and Sixt.
- In addition to being known as "Minsk National Airport", another name for MSQ is "Нацыянальны аэрапорт МінскНациональный аэропорт Минск".
- Minsk international airport is linked to the capital by the M2 motorway.
- The closest airport to Minsk National Airport (MSQ) is Minsk-1 Airport (MHP), which is located 20 miles (32 kilometers) W of MSQ.
- In 2009 airport served 1,010,695 passengers out of which 682,000 were served by the national airline Belavia.
- The furthest airport from Minsk National Airport (MSQ) is Chatham Islands (CHT), which is located 11,134 miles (17,918 kilometers) away in Waitangi, Chatham Islands, New Zealand.
- Minsk National Airport (MSQ) currently has only 1 runway.
- Because of Minsk National Airport's relatively low elevation of 669 feet, planes can take off or land at Minsk National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
